Optical Obstacle Course
Those three fast-food fellows of filmic flavours at the
Film and Video Umbrella have teamed with FirstSite
and John Hansard Gallery to launch an "Obstacle Course
and other works" by John Wood and Paul Harrison
Not to put the kids playpark at your local McDonalds
out of business, we are assured that: "the Obstacle Course
and other works is a touring exhibition of new installation
pieces by this collaborative duo of video artists, known
for visually surprising experiments in which they test
themselves out in relation to constructed physical
elements. The videos that document these playful actions
have a simple composition and formal elegance." Sorry,
would you like fries with that?
The fantastically sounding "Plinth", and "Circular Walk",
are additional attractions to the exhibition as well as a
number of specially-built structures, reminiscent of 70's
minimal sculpture. You will hear the sound of someone
clambering over, through or under these objects
continuously throughout the gallery ... but they kept all
the good words till last: "Distinguished by an unerring
sense of timing and a droll economy of effort, these
witty and inventive pieces combine a playful capacity
for surprise with a deceptive formal elegance." We'll
definitely Eat-In for this one.
Obstacle Course and other works is on tour from June
19 - Jan 15, 2000 at various "drive-through" locations
around the country. Check the web site for full details.
